Bathroom Demolition in Frederick, MD
Bathroom demolition services involve the careful removal of existing fixtures, tiles, cabinetry, and other structures within a bathroom space. This process is often requested during remodeling projects, renovations, or when preparing a bathroom for a complete rebuild. Property owners typically want to understand the scope of demolition, including what will be removed and how the space will be prepared for the next phase of construction, ensuring minimal disruption to the rest of the property.
Before requesting bathroom demolition, homeowners should consider factors such as the extent of the demolition needed, whether plumbing or electrical components will be affected, and any specific disposal requirements for debris. It’s also helpful to clarify if the demolition includes removal of fixtures like toilets, bathtubs, or vanities, and to discuss any concerns about protecting surrounding areas during the process. Clear communication about project details can help ensure a smooth and efficient demolition experience.

Common Bathroom Demolition Jobs
Bathroom Demolition - involves removing existing fixtures, tiles, and structures to prepare for remodeling.
Complete Bathroom Demolition - includes tearing out all elements for a full renovation or redesign.
Partial Bathroom Demolition - focuses on removing specific features like tubs, vanities, or walls for updates.
Wall Removal - entails demolishing non-load-bearing walls to create more space or open layouts.
Fixture Removal - involves safely taking out sinks, toilets, and cabinets before new installations.
Floor and Tile Removal - includes stripping outdated or damaged flooring and wall tiles for replacement.
Bathroom Demolition Questions
What does bathroom demolition involve? Bathroom demolition includes removing fixtures, tiles, and structures to prepare the space for remodeling or renovation projects.
When should a bathroom be demolished? Demolition is typically needed when updating outdated layouts, replacing damaged components, or starting a complete renovation.
Is bathroom demolition messy? Demolition can create dust and debris, so proper containment and cleanup are important parts of the process.
What should property owners consider before demolition? It's important to plan for proper disposal of debris, protect surrounding areas, and ensure plumbing and electrical systems are handled safely.
